French car manufacturing company Citroën India has introduced its popular hatchback with a CNG variant. The company has introduced the Citroën C3 with CNG retrofitment. Now people looking for CNG have got another option in the Indian market. Citroën has 3-4 cars in its portfolio, in which the company has introduced a hatchback with a CNG variant. C3 CNG will be available at all the dealerships of the company with a certified retrofitment program.

Special features of Citroën C3 CNG

This car claims a mileage of 28.1 km/kg. The car comes with a factory fitted CNG kit. This car takes a running cost of Rs 2.66 per kilometer. Seamless integration has been given in the car. It has a 1.2 liter engine.

The car gets a warranty of 3 years or 1 lakh km. This is a vehicle warranty and CNG components are also given. CNG has been fitted in the car in such a way that there is no difference in the boot space. Apart from this, spare wheels can be removed easily.

How much price will have to be paid?

The company has informed that Rs 93000 will have to be paid for this car i.e. a separate CNG kit. Talking about other specifications, the rear shock absorber in the car has been tuned. Suspension springs have been reinforced. These CNG retrofitment kits can be purchased from any authorized dealership.

Every car will first undergo a pre-delivery inspection. This includes cylinder integrity, leak detection, pressure regulation and seamless fuel switching. So that there is no compromise on the safety and emission norms of the car.
